At Marros Riding Centre, we have a range of riding sessions to suit all levels of rider. We have an indoor and outdoor school for those looking to learn a new skill or improve their existing riding skills and our own off road private woodland for those looking to explore the lovely West Wales countryside. For experienced riders, we are close to Morfa Bychan Beach where we can often ride onto the seven mile Pendine Sands and gallop along the surf.
Please note: We have a weight limit of 16 stone. Each horse has a weight limit and they are allocated using heights and weights provided. Please be honest and accurate with weights for the horses’ welfare.
Ideal for children, beginners and families
An hour session split into two halves. The first half is a basic lesson where you learn and practice how to start, stop, steer and even try a trot. We then head out for a trek in the woodland where you can test out your new skills. Staff go on foot to give a helping hand if needed. Children or nervous riders are led when necessary.
Suitable for any level rider
We ride in our own unspoilt, ancient woodland with trickling streams, wild garlic and local wildlife. Staff can go on foot with beginners or nervous riders for a gentle walk or escort on horseback for those that can trot or canter. When there are mixed ability parties, we go to the level of the least experienced rider.
Suitable for riders confident and competent to canter*
We ride along the road a short distance onto byways and farm tracks which allow us to take in the beautiful scenery and have a number of trots and canters. We ride to Ragwen Point where we can enjoy panoramic views of Carmarthen Bay as well as South Pembrokeshire.
We have another route that can be used April-October which goes through our woodland, cross over the road and around our 60 acres there. It has many different terrains and lovely cantering opportunities. This ride also has amazing sea views and landscape.
*This ride does allow us to take less experienced riders on longer treks at our discretion.
Suitable for riders over 16 years that are confident and competent to gallop and do so regularly
We are lucky enough to be situated riding distance from the beach. We ride along byways and farm tracks which allow riders to have a few trots and canters to get used to your horse’s movements before getting to the beach. Once on the beach, we gradually work through the speeds. We ride on the sand, in the surf and, if the weather allows, we go for a paddle in the sea. The ride is 2 and a half hours long and we take a maximum of 6 clients to ensure an enjoyable and personal experience.
Beach rides are tide dependent and as we need to assess the beach and sand on the day, we cannot guarantee a gallop on every beach ride. Spectators are able to drive to Pendine Sands and walk around the cliffs at the right hand side onto Morfa Bychan to watch. Our ride stays along the surf line so if you wanted to watch closely, you would need to be near the sea.
Riders must be over 16 years old and able to gallop for this ride for the safety of the rider, horse, other riders as well as people on the beach. We assess your riding en route to the beach. If we believe you are not up to the required standard, for safety purposes we reserve the right to not take you on the beach. Please be truthful with your ability to avoid these situations.
From total beginner to BHS Stages training
We offer one to one, semi-private or group lessons of up to six riders. For private or semi private (two people) lessons, we offer 30 or 45 minute durations. For a group lesson, we offer 30 or 60 minutes. We have qualified and experienced riding instructors that can teach you either flatwork or jumping.
Great for children over 8 years old - any riding ability
Run from 10.30-3.30 on Wednesdays in the school holidays, Own-a-pony days offer plenty of opportunities for pampering and cuddling ponies. The day starts with an introduction, quick safety briefing and tour of the yard. We then go and meet the allocated ponies, give them a groom and tack them up. We explain the different brushes and their uses. Next is a riding lesson to work up an appetite before lunch. We then head out for a trek after lunch and to finish off we untack the ponies and sweep the barns including scooping up horse poo!
What to bring: packed lunch, warm clothes that can get mucky. Waterproofs if the weather is doubtful! Wellies are great for when we are around the yard.
Ideal for the little ones! No minimum (or maximum) age limit as long as hat and boots fit
The Toddler Taster Session is great if you’re not sure what your little one will make of being on a horse. It lasts approximately 10 minutes. We go in the indoor school, spectators can join as well to take photos and be there for support. We introduce the child to the pony and encourage they stroke them to say hello. We then pop them on board and have two laps of the school with lots of photo opportunities. Next,we feed the pony a couple of treats to finish.
A group to encourage toddlers to spend more time around horses and the outdoors
An hour long session includes pony ride, brushing, snack & drink and craft/messy play. An adult must stay with the child to supervise. Held on Wednesdays at 11am -term time only.
Booking is essential.
Juniors are suitable for age 3-8 years and Seniors for 8 years and over
Once a month we hold activity morning/afternoon sessions for Juniors and an activity day for the seniors. We cover sessions like grooming, tacking up, riding lessons, untacking, cleaning and badge work. Perfect for those children that enjoy being outdoors or around horses. No previous experience is necessary and children are supervised at all times. Children will need to be a member of The Pony Club which has an annual fee. We hold a show once a year and a Presentation Evening in November.
